JEC Composites and Industry Leaders Explore Trends in Composites at the 2013 Boston Innovative Composites Summit (I.C.S.)

By Patrick Curran | August 13, 2013

Share

Presented in conjunction with the JEC Americas Composites Show & Conferences at the Boston Convention and Exhibition Center, October 2-4, 2013, this event will showcase the vision, expertise and insights of top business and technology leaders from the global composites industry. The program is designed to help attendees understand macro trends affecting industry sectors including aeronautics and automotive, materials such as carbon, thermoplastics and biocomposites, and cutting-edge processing and design approaches.

The I.C.S. conference will highlight the viewpoints of those who are breaking new ground in the composites industry. Top thinkers from business, technology and government will share their insights in:

Design & Processing Forums
Productivity & Robotization session: Increasing productivity while maintaining the same level of quality, whether in the materials or the processes, is the main challenge here. From on-line quality control to post-machining, rework and repair, automation is the key to mass production in the composite materials industry. Because of the high-level quality demanded by applications sectors such as aeronautics and automotive, automated production has faced many challenges.

Biocomposites session: Global manufacturers in many sectors are generating a growing market pull for composite materials that can be used to create lighter, stronger products with reduced costs and energy consumption. The presenters in this session represent key components of this global movement to deliver the potential of biocomposites to the industry.

Application Sector Forums
Aeronautics session: In the aircraft industry, composite materials have been more and more widely used. Indeed, they offer the possibility to overcome obstacles that have been encountered when using individual materials. The key improvement they provide is structural strength comparable to metallic parts but at a lighter weight.

Materials Forums
Carbon session: Carbon fibers have long been specifically used in high-quality but restrained industries, due to their elevated manufacturing cost. However, their unsurpassed strength-to-weight ratio has made carbon fibers highly necessary in application sectors such as automotive and aeronautics.

Thermoplastics session: Over the last few decades, thermoplastic composites have gained market share and importance. The unique properties of thermoplastic composites, such as toughness and impact resistance, along with recyclability have created a lot of new opportunities.
